✦ Synopsis


Resonances due to level-crossings when the Zeeman interactions in two radical pairs become equal to the average electron exchange interaction as the magnetic field is increased are reported from studies in static fields, in MARY experiments, and from rotating fields in RYDMR B, experiments. The assignment of these low-field features to exchange effects is confirmed from observations made on changing the relative permittivities of the solutions. The systems studied were created by flash photolysis of pyrene in the presence of dimethylaniline and, separately, of the three isomers of dicyanobenzene.
